在Linux上安装Java的详细教程

Java是一种广泛使用的编程语言,通常用于开发平台独立的应用程序。在Linux系统上安装Java,可以帮助你在开发过程中顺利运行Java程序。本文将为你详细介绍如何在Linux上安装Java,过程简单易懂。

安装Java的流程

下面的表格展示了安装Java的步骤:

步骤 描述
1 更新系统的软件包列表
2 安装Java软件包
3 设置Java环境变量
4 验证Java安装

步骤详解

1. 更新系统的软件包列表

在安装Java之前,我们需要确保系统的软件包列表是最新的。打开终端,输入以下命令:

sudo apt update

这条命令的作用是更新系统的包管理器,以确保可以下载到最新的软件包。

2. 安装Java软件包

接下来,我们可以安装OpenJDK(开放的Java开发工具包)。使用以下命令进行安装:

sudo apt install openjdk-11-jdk

这条命令的作用是安装OpenJDK 11版本及其开发工具包,11是比较稳定的版本,通常适合大多数用户。

3. 设置Java环境变量

安装完Java后,我们需要设置Java的环境变量,以便在终端中可以直接使用Java命令。首先,我们使用以下命令查找Java的安装路径:

sudo update-alternatives --config java

这条命令将列出已安装的Java版本及其路径,选择适合的版本。

接下来,打开环境变量配置文件:

sudo nano /etc/environment

使用nano文本编辑器打开环境变量配置文件。

在打开的文件中,添加以下环境变量(假设Java的路径是/usr/lib/jvm/java-11-openjdk-amd64/bin):

JAVA_HOME="/usr/lib/jvm/java-11-openjdk-amd64"
PATH="$PATH:$JAVA_HOME/bin"

JAVA_HOME变量指向Java的安装目录,PATH变量确保系统能够找到Java可执行文件。

保存修改并退出nano(按CTRL + X,然后按Y确认保存,最后按Enter键)。

刷新环境变量:

source /etc/environment

这条命令的作用是使上一步的环境变量修改生效。

4. 验证Java安装

最后,我们需要验证Java是否安装成功。输入以下命令:

java -version

如果正确安装,系统将显示Java的版本信息。

我们也可以验证javac(Java编译器)是否安装成功:

javac -version

同样,如果正确安装,系统将显示Java编译器的版本信息。

安装流程总结

为了更清晰地看到整个流程,我们可以用序列图表示安装流程:

sequenceDiagram
    participant User as 用户
    participant Terminal as 终端
    participant PackageManager as 包管理器

    User->>Terminal: 打开终端
    Terminal->>PackageManager: sudo apt update
    PackageManager-->>Terminal: 更新完成
    Terminal->>PackageManager: sudo apt install openjdk-11-jdk
    PackageManager-->>Terminal: 安装完成
    Terminal->>Terminal: sudo update-alternatives --config java
    Terminal->>Terminal: sudo nano /etc/environment
    Terminal->>Terminal: 添加环境变量
    Terminal->>Terminal: source /etc/environment
    Terminal->>Terminal: java -version
    Terminal-->>User: 显示Java版本
    Terminal->>Terminal: javac -version
    Terminal-->>User: 显示javac版本

结论

通过以上步骤,你已成功在Linux上安装了Java。掌握Java的安装过程后,你可以开始学习Java编程,开发各种应用程序。在未来的编程旅程中,请记得不断实践和探索,这将帮助你成为一名优秀的开发者。如果你在安装过程中遇到问题,不妨查阅相关文档或向他人求助,社区的支持也会让你的学习之路更加轻松。祝你学习顺利,编程愉快!